Illinoian

 
Pronunciation: /ˌɪlɪˈnɔɪ(j)ən/

adjective

Geology
  • relating to or denoting a Pleistocene glaciation in North America, preceding the Wisconsin and approximating to the Saale of northern Europe.
  • (as noun the Illinoian) the Illinoian glaciation or the system of deposits laid down during it.

Origin:

mid 19th century: from Illinois + -an
